JNJ vs BAX in plain English
- JNJ is the bigger company — about 53.9× the market cap of BAX.
- JNJ earns a higher return on equity (26% vs -15%).
- JNJ is growing revenue faster (10% vs 3%).
- JNJ has the higher dividend yield (2.10% vs 0.91%).
